Leon Speakers Intros Horizon Speakers for Videoconferencing, Telepresence [PR]
Delivers high fidelity sound and high definition video all in one sleek cabinet for optimal performance
Ann Arbor, MI ─ Leon Speakers, leaders in the custom high-fidelity audio industry, today introduced its new HorizonTM Interactive Series of high-performance, vocally optimized audio solutions for telepresence and video conferencing systems. The Horizon Interactive Personal Unit speakers (for single displays) and Multi-Display speakers (for any number of panels) combine high fidelity sound and high definition video all in one sleek cabinet with custom-sized housings for video conferencing hardware. This combination allows the audio experience to be in perfect proximity to the video source, creating a truly immersive, world-class system.
“After working with the top global integrators on telepresence installations over the past 10 years, we’ve developed a scalable audio solution that enables you to mount any telepresence camera directly within our speaker enclosure,” said Noah Kaplan, President of Leon Speakers. “This allows for easier installation and helps to place both the speaker and the camera in optimal locations as it can be mounted above or below any display. It’s also more aesthetically appealing since the cabinet is built to match the exact dimensions and finish of the screen, which is ultimately our goal for both residential and commercial environments.”
Focused on the corporate video conferencing and telepresence market, the HorizonTM Interactive speakers are optimized for vocal clarity and a wide sound stage, giving the sense of different people in different places. A camera cabinet is custom crafted into the speaker to accommodate the full range of motion of the specified camera(s), including: Tandberg 1080, Polycomm HDX and Sony EV cameras, among others. Each project also includes engineering time, 2D CAD and 3D visualizations of each system and custom brackets suitable for any installation.
The Personal Units and Multi-Display speakers deliver powerful and versatile solutions for a variety of corporate and commercial needs — from traditional video conferencing to more demanding HD presentations. The speakers are offered in a number of configurations that include three-way speaker designs, angled baffles to support above or below screen mounting and custom finishes to complement the design of any installation. Each speaker is handcrafted and built-to-order in Ann Arbor, Michigan to match the exact dimensions and finish of any single display or array of multiple displays. The Personal Units and Multi-Displays will be shipping June 15, 2011.
